The 103rd Open | 1974 Royal Lytham & St Annes

Player becomes a Champion in three decades

For a long time, Harry Vardon and J.H. Taylor were the only players to win The Open in three different decades. In 1974 they were matched by Gary Player.

Royal Lytham & St Annes played host to Player's most emphatic victory as he triumphed by four strokes from Peter Oosterhuis despite three bogeys in the final four holes.
